温馨提示×

timewait状态的最佳管理策略

小樊
88
2024-07-04 18:35:29
栏目: 编程语言

Timewait状态是TCP连接中的一种状态,当连接被关闭时,会进入timewait状态一段时间,以确保双方都接收到了关闭连接的信息。

最佳的管理策略包括以下几点:

  1. 调整TCP连接的超时时间:可以通过修改系统参数来调整timewait状态的超时时间,以适应不同的网络环境和连接需求。

  2. 使用连接重用机制:在服务器端可以使用连接重用机制,减少timewait状态的出现。当一个连接关闭后,可以将其重新用于其他连接,而不必等待timewait状态的超时。

  3. 使用连接池:在高并发情况下,可以使用连接池来管理TCP连接,以减少连接的创建和关闭次数,从而减少timewait状态的出现。

  4. 优化网络传输性能:通过优化网络传输性能,如增加带宽、减少延迟等方式,可以减少连接的建立和关闭次数,从而减少timewait状态的出现。

  5. 监控和调优:定期监控系统的TCP连接状态,及时发现timewait状态过多的情况,并进行调优处理,以确保系统的稳定性和性能。

综上所述,最佳的管理策略是综合考虑各种因素,包括网络环境、连接需求和系统性能,采取相应的措施来减少timewait状态的出现,提升系统的稳定性和性能。

0